Hillcroft is a homely four-bedroom semi-detached house located in the beautiful harbour village of Abersoch, Gwynedd, in Wales. This family-friendly property sleeps up to six guests and welcomes pets, making it an ideal base for a seaside getaway. The house features a spacious front lawn with seating, a well-equipped kitchen/diner, a utility/cloakroom, and a cozy sitting room with a Smart TV and gas fire.
On the first floor, guests will find a shower room and four well-presented bedrooms, including three doubles and a single, all with ample storage space. The village of Abersoch offers leisurely walks along the harbour, fresh seafood dining options, and a convenience store for stocking up on essentials. Abersoch Beach is perfect for swimming, paddleboarding, and wakeboarding, while the local golf club provides stunning sea views for golf enthusiasts.
For more adventures, guests can explore nearby Pwllheli with its own beach and golf club, as well as Discover Llŷn for e-bike rentals and guided tours of the Llŷn Peninsula. Further afield, Criccieth offers a historic castle, sandy beaches, and fishing opportunities at Eisteddfa Fishery & Café. Nearby Porthmadog provides attractions like the Welsh Highland Heritage Railway, Traeth Glaslyn North Wales Wildlife Trust Nature Reserve, and Black Rock Llamas.
